## Configuration

Stencilcrest performs incremental rebuilds by hashing page inputs and rebuilding only changed routes. REBUILD_CONCURRENCY sets parallel workers (default 4). REBUILD_CACHE_DIR must be writable and persist between CI runs, or every build becomes a full rebuild. Reviewers should confirm that cache invalidation covers shared layout changes. The rebuild service fetches content from the Quillbase API, and the token it uses is defined on the following line.

sealed setting: LEDGER_TOKEN13=5d842615a26d7

Handover Note — from Director Elin Varsk to Director Tomas Reel

Heads of department: Dravenmoor plant decision is unresolved. Option A adds a third shift; Option B commissions the Olst line. Costings from Penwick Consulting arrive Thursday. Board expects a recommendation within two weeks. Tomas takes ownership from today; all queries route to him. The confidential plan under consideration follows below.

internal memo for hafog-hadug: The pricing group signed off on a budget of $16.1 million for Project Gorir. The renewal with Oliionax Systems closes at $14.1 million a year, 46 percent above the last contract.

Handover Note — Loyalty Programme Overhaul

Hi all — as I pass the reins to Director Cobb, a quick summary for the finance team. The Lanternmark rewards scheme at Orvello Retail is being rebuilt: points expiry shortens to 18 months, redemption tiers simplify to three, and the breakage assumption needs re-estimating before year-end. Systems work is on track; accruals are not. Cobb will chair the steering group from Monday. The confidential plan summary sits directly below for your eyes only.

management briefing: Project Juleth slips by two quarters because of the audit delay.

# Break-Glass: Catalog Cache Invalidation

Scope: the Pinrow product catalog at Veldstone Retail. If stale prices persist after a purge and the Hollowmere invalidation queue is wedged, use break-glass to flush the edge tier directly. Contractors: get verbal sign-off from the catalog lead first. Steps: open the Hollowmere admin shell, select emergency-flush, confirm the tenant, and run it once — repeated flushes thrash the origin. Access is logged and expires after 20 minutes. Unseal the admin shell with the passphrase below.

recovery phrase for kahop-tajog: istix-casvan